Altair RapidMiner Unveils Advanced AI Agent Framework for Enhanced Predictive Analytics
Wednesday, Dec 18, 2024 7:14 am ET
Altair RapidMiner, a leading data science platform, has recently introduced its Advanced AI Agent Framework, a groundbreaking feature that empowers businesses to unlock next-level capabilities in predictive analytics and decision-making. This innovative framework enables the creation of intelligent, autonomous AI agents that can learn, adapt, and make decisions independently, improving efficiency and accuracy in data-driven processes.
The Advanced AI Agent Framework offers several key features that set it apart from traditional data science tools. Firstly, AI agents can learn from data and adapt their models without human intervention, continuously improving predictive capabilities. This autonomous learning capability allows businesses to stay ahead of the curve in rapidly evolving data landscapes. Secondly, AI agents can make decisions in real-time, enabling timely responses to changing market conditions and customer behaviors. This agility is crucial for businesses seeking to capitalize on opportunities and mitigate risks. Lastly, the framework allows for the deployment of multiple AI agents, enabling parallel processing and faster analysis of large datasets. This scalability ensures that businesses can handle the increasing volume and complexity of data without compromising performance.
The Advanced AI Agent Framework is particularly well-suited for industries such as financial services, healthcare, and manufacturing. In the financial sector, AI agents can optimize trading strategies, detect fraud, and manage risk more effectively. In healthcare, they can improve patient outcomes by predicting disease progression and optimizing treatment plans. In manufacturing, AI agents can enhance quality control, optimize supply chains, and predict equipment failures, leading to increased productivity and reduced costs.

To illustrate the potential of the Advanced AI Agent Framework, consider the following example. A manufacturing company deploys AI agents to monitor equipment performance and predict maintenance needs. The AI agents analyze historical data, identify patterns, and make real-time predictions about equipment failures. By proactively addressing maintenance issues, the company can minimize downtime, reduce repair costs, and improve overall productivity.
The Advanced AI Agent Framework has demonstrated impressive results in real-world applications. A study conducted by Altair RapidMiner found that AI agents reduced prediction errors by an average of 35% compared to traditional machine learning models. Additionally, AI agents improved decision-making efficiency by 40% in complex data environments.
